the best part of Moustache is (by far) the dry down after 75 minutes. which is a semi-sweet woodsy-vanilla scent. plus a subtle combo of rose/mandarine/pinkpepper sparkling in the backgound. the opening is also very nice: all of the notes at once in your face with dominating vanilla and PATCHOULY. distictive, inoffensive, and elegant.
